This luxurious Beach front resort is set in above sixty two ft² of tropical gardens, and includes a variety of services to help keep you active or help you rest – all beneath The nice and cozy sunshine of Majorca.Villa Cala Mendia is a just lately renovated trip dwelling in Cala Mendia exactly where guests can take advantage of of its outside sw